A popular perfume by Boadicea the Victorious for women and men. The release year is unknown. The scent is woody-spicy. The longevity is above-average. It is still in production.

I M P E R I A L
Imperial from the British House of Haute Luxury Niche Perfumery Boadicea The Victorious is a Oriental Woody Spicy Amber Floral Unisex perfume. I found it more masculine.
Imperial is a fragrance that bridges the gap between East and West, combining powerful oriental notes with the refined legacy of English perfumery. It follows the same proposal as the iconic Oud Wood, it is not a copy, it is even more perfume than Tom Ford's classic.

The fragrance opens with a delicious penetrating woody blend of a raw rosewood, immediately blending with a light smokiness of birch, with a pungent duet of lavender and angelica, providing a woody, fresh, aromatic and smoky opening at the same time. A majestic exit making a seamless transition to the heart of the fragrance.

As the fragrance evolves, a rich masculine floral bouquet emerges, led by geranium, rose and jasmine adding a softness and sophistication. And bringing a refined vibe to the composition. This floral core is the essence of elegance, balancing the fragrance with its charming and delicate aroma. This delicate lightness at the heart of the perfume perfectly balances this creation.

The base is a luxurious and exotic blend with the woody creaminess of Indian sandalwood, a light touch of medicinal smoky Cambodian oud, subtle incense, with the dark and resinous labdanum. Sandalwood provides a creamy warmth, 'oud adds a rich, resinous depth, giving the fragrance its smoky resinous woody character. And yet Imperial is surprisingly fresh and versatile that has made it famous.

Olfactory Journey
Woody, yet floral. Spicy, yet fresh. Imperial introduces itself sharp and slightly off putting, but one must keep in mind that the house of Boadicea uses raw materials. Many of their blends smell very natural and often take time to unfold. The dry down is stunning. Rose is not a prominent note, but you can catch it peeking its petals through a full floral heart of this composition. The lavender here is so finely blended, that it doesn’t strike you as lavender. It has been merged with several other notes to forge something rather distinctive. I find that this fragrance smells almost completely different when smelling close range versus catching intermittent wafts. I was not immediately reminded of TF Oud Wood or Creed's Royal Oud, but find that it does fall into that category. If you smell hard enough, the oud and rosewood combination is reminiscent of Oud Wood. Those who compared Imperial to Angel A*Men may seem way off looking at the note scheme, but I do get very subtle whispers of A*Men 45 minutes into wear. Lavender, sandalwood and patchouli perhaps? Imperial may vaguely remind you of a few existing scents out there, but is definitely its own fragrance. Classy, unique and high profile. Imperial will take you on a thrilling olfactory journey.

Boadicea Imperial
This is, without exaggeration, one of the biggest disappointments I’ve experienced in niche perfumery.
Imperial quickly reveals itself as a fragrance built almost entirely around a blunt, synthetic ambroxan / woody-amber core. Any initial promise disappears fast, and what remains is a flat, aggressive, chemical dryness with no soul, no evolution, and no luxury feel whatsoever.
The drydown is painfully reminiscent of Fragrance du Bois Lucius — the same harsh ambroxan overload that feels cheap, mass-produced, and completely out of place at this price level. To my nose, this smells closer to an inexpensive Middle Eastern clone fragrance than to anything that should carry a luxury niche price tag.
For a brand like Boadicea the Victorious, this feels like a complete misfire. Stripped of its marketing, bottle, and hype, the scent itself offers nothing refined or memorable. In my opinion, it is vastly overpriced and fundamentally unworthy of its reputation.
